New York producer, vocalist and DJ Vitesse X has shared her take on Filter’s late-90s alt-rock classic ‘Take A Picture‘, following her recent single ‘Memori‘.
Vitesse X seriously always delivers, but this one feels extra special — it’s extremely nostalgic, bringing me straight back to the end of the 90s, and I low-key think this might be one of my favourite things she has ever done.
The cover pulls the song out of its post-grunge context and into something hazier and more suspended, built around trip-hop-leaning drums and atmospheric dream-pop production. The addition of the guitars fits like an absolute glove and I just adore this soundscape.
Speaking about the track, Vitesse X shares:
“I was listening to ‘Take a Picture’ in the car in the winter, deep in some heavy emotions. When the song came on, I was immediately transported back to a feeling I had completely forgotten existed. A time where life felt tangible and simple and pure. It was honestly transcendental.”
